Yes, depending on your phone and projector, you can hook up your phone to a projector using different methods such as HDMI cable, USB cable, wireless connection, or through a specialized adapter. Some projectors may have built-in support for specific mobile devices, while others require additional hardware. It is recommended to consult the manual of your projector and phone for specific instructions on how to connect them.

How to Connect Your Phone to a Projector: Everything You Need to Know

In todays technology-driven world, we rely heavily on our smartphones for entertainment, communication, and work-related tasks. But what do you do when you want to display something from your phone, like a movie or presentation, on a much larger screen? The answer is simple: hook it up to a projector. Yes, it is indeed possible to connect your phone to a projector, and in this article, we’ll give you everything you need to know to make it happen.

Before we get started, its worth noting that the method for connecting your phone to a projector may vary depending on the type of projector and phone you have. But no worries—we’ve got you covered with these simple steps:

1. Check the ports on your projector
First things first, you need to check the ports on your projector to know what cables you need to connect it to your phone. Most projectors have either an HDMI port or a VGA port. These are standard interfaces that will easily connect with compatible devices.

2. Look for the right cable or adapter
Once you know what ports are available on your projector, you need to find the right cable or adapter to connect your phone to it. For an HDMI port, you can use an HDMI cable, which is readily available at most electronic stores. If your projector only has VGA ports, however, you’ll need a VGA adapter, which can be bought online or at an electronic store.

3. Connect your phone to the projector
Once you have everything you need, simply connect your phone to the projector using the appropriate cables or adapter. For example, if you’re using an HDMI cable, connect one end to your phone and the other to the projectors HDMI port. If youre using a VGA adapter, connect the adapter to your phones charging port and then plug the VGA cable into that adapter, then connect the other end of the VGA cable to the projectors VGA port.

4. Configure the projector settings
With your phone connected to the projector, youll need to configure your projectors settings. On most projectors, you’ll need to change the input source to HDMI or VGA, depending on how you connected your phone. Once you’ve made the switch, you should be able to see the contents of your phone displayed on the projectors screen.

In conclusion, if you want to hook up your phone to a projector, its actually quite simple. Just follow the steps we’ve outlined above, and you’ll be enjoying your favorite movies, games, or presentations on a bigger screen in no time. So, go ahead and give it a try!

How to Connect Your Phone to a Projector

If you are tired of watching videos on a small phone screen, you might be wondering if you can connect your phone to a projector for a larger viewing experience. The answer is yes, you can hook up your phone to a projector, and it’s easier than you might think.

There are various ways to connect your phone to a projector, and the method you choose will depend on the type of phone you have and the type of projector you are using. Here are a few options to consider:

1. HDMI Cable: If your phone supports HDMI output, you can connect it to a projector using an HDMI cable. Simply plug one end of the cable into your phone’s HDMI port and the other end into the projector’s HDMI port. Make sure the projector is set to HDMI input and you should be ready to go.

2. Wireless Connection: Many projectors now have built-in Wi-Fi that allows you to connect wirelessly to your phone. To do this, you will need to download the projector’s app onto your phone and follow the instructions to connect.

3. USB Connection: Some projectors also have a USB port that you can use to connect your phone. You will need a USB adapter that is compatible with your phone’s charging port to do this.

No matter which method you choose, you will need to make sure that your phone’s screen is mirrored on the projector. This can usually be done by adjusting the display settings on your phone.

Connecting your phone to a projector can be a great way to enjoy videos and photos on a larger screen. Just make sure you have the right cables or adapters, and you should be good to go.

How to Make Your Own Projector Screen: A Step-by-Step Guide

Projector screens are great tools for creating a movie theater experience in your own home. While they can be purchased readily in the market, making your own projector screen can be a fun and fulfilling project. Additionally, it can help you save some money while providing you with the perfect screen size and material of your choice. In this article, we will guide you through the process of making your own projector screen.

Materials Required

- Projector fabric or blackout cloth
- Black felt
- Two-inch wooden frame
- Staple gun
- Saw
- Screws and screwdriver
- Sandpaper
- Drill

Step 1: Prepare the Frame

The first step in making your own projector screen is to prepare the wooden frame. Cut the wooden frame to the desired size using a saw. Sand the edges of the frame to avoid any injury while handling it. Next, use the drill to create pilot holes in the corners of the frame.

Step 2: Attach the Fabric

Once the frame is ready, lay the projector fabric or blackout cloth on a smooth surface. Place the frame on top of the fabric. Ensure that there is enough fabric to cover the entire frame on all sides. Then use the staple gun to attach the fabric on the edges of the frame. Start by stapling one corner of the fabric to the frame, stretch the fabric taut, and staple the corner opposite to it. Repeat this on the remaining corners.

Step 3: Fix the Black Felt

The next step is fixing the black felt on the back of the wooden frame. The felt helps in absorbing any light that may seep through the fabric. Cut the black felt to size and use the staple gun to attach it along the edges of the wooden frame.

Step 4: Finishing Touches

Once the black felt is fixed, attach any necessary mounting fixtures or hooks to the wooden frame. Ensure that they are sturdy enough to hold the weight of the screen.

Congratulations, your homemade projector screen is now ready for use! Place it where you want and enjoy the experience of watching your favorite movies or shows on the big screen.

Conclusion

Making your own projector screen is a fun project that can help you save money while providing you with a screen that meets your specific needs. Ensure that you choose the right materials and follow the step-by-step guide provided above for the desired outcome. A DIY projector screen is a great way to enhance your home entertainment experience without breaking the bank.

Can I Hook My Phone Up to My Projector?

The short answer is yes, you can hook your phone up to your projector, but the process may differ depending on the type of phone and projector you have. In this article, we will cover the steps required to connect your phone to a projector and the different methods available.

Method 1: Using an HDMI cable

If your projector has an HDMI input, you can easily connect your phone to it using an HDMI cable. To do this, you will need a compatible phone with an HDMI output or a USB-C port. You will also need an HDMI cable. Once you have these, follow the steps below:

1. Plug the HDMI cable into the projector’s HDMI input port.
2. Connect the other end of the HDMI cable to your phone’s HDMI output port or USB-C port.
3. Turn on your projector and select the HDMI input source.
4. Your phone’s screen should now be displayed on the projector. If not, check your phone’s settings and ensure that the output is set to HDMI.

Method 2: Using a wireless connection

Some projectors allow for wireless connection through Bluetooth or Wi-Fi. This method is ideal for those who do not want to deal with cables. To connect wirelessly, follow the steps below:

1. Turn on Bluetooth or Wi-Fi on your phone and projector.
2. On your phone, select the projector from the list of available devices.
3. The projector should prompt a connection request, which you should accept.
4. Your phone’s screen should now be displayed on the projector.

Method 3: Using a specialized adapter

If your phone does not have an HDMI output or USB-C port, you can still connect it to a projector through a specialized adapter. These adapters usually connect to your phone’s charging port and have an HDMI or VGA output port. To use this method, follow the steps below:

1. Purchase a specialized adapter that is compatible with your phone and projector.
2. Plug the adapter into your phone’s charging port.
3. Connect the adapter’s HDMI or VGA output port to the projector’s input port.
4. Turn on your projector and select the input source.

In conclusion, connecting your phone to a projector is easy and can be done in several ways. By following the methods outlined in this article, you can enjoy your phone’s content on a larger screen.
